Why India’s Hospitals Are Globally Trusted

India’s healthcare sector has seen rapid growth over the last two decades. Here’s what makes the best hospitals in India stand out:

World-Class Infrastructure: Top hospitals have state-of-the-art equipment, modular OTs, hybrid cath labs, robotic systems, and AI-based diagnostics.

Globally Acclaimed Doctors: Many Indian doctors are trained or have fellowships from top institutions in the US, UK, or Europe.

Affordability: High-end surgeries like organ transplants, cardiac procedures, or cancer treatments cost a fraction of what they do in Western countries.

Accreditations: Leading hospitals have NABH (National Accreditation Board for Hospitals) or international JCI (Joint Commission International) certifications.

Medical Tourism: India attracts thousands of patients every year from Africa, the Middle East, and South Asia thanks to cost-effective, quality care.

1. All India Institute of Medical Sciences (AIIMS), New Delhi

Why AIIMS Leads:
AIIMS, New Delhi, is India’s most prestigious government hospital and medical research institute. It offers highly subsidized treatment, making advanced healthcare accessible to all.

Specialties:

  • Neurosurgery, cardiac surgery, organ transplants
  • Oncology, endocrinology, pediatrics
  • Cutting-edge research and clinical trials

What Makes AIIMS Unique:
It treats lakhs of patients annually, trains the nation’s top doctors, and sets benchmarks in research and innovation.

2. Apollo Hospitals, Chennai

The flagship of the Apollo Group, Apollo Hospitals Chennai is one of Asia’s best-known super-specialty hospitals.

Key Highlights:

  • NABH and JCI accredited.
  • Pioneer in heart transplants and robotic surgeries in India.
  • Specialties: Cardiac sciences, oncology, organ transplants, neurosciences.

Why Patients Trust Apollo:
Apollo combines advanced technology with world-class specialists, attracting patients from 120+ countries every year.

3. Medanta – The Medicity, Gurugram

Founded by renowned cardiac surgeon Dr. Naresh Trehan, Medanta is one of India’s largest multi-specialty hospitals.

Specialties:

  • Organ transplants, robotic surgery.
  • Cardiac sciences, neurosciences, oncology.
  • Minimally invasive surgeries.

Unique Features:
It’s spread over 45 acres with over 1,600 beds and 800+ top doctors. Medanta is particularly famous for its Heart Institute.

4. Fortis Memorial Research Institute (FMRI), Gurugram

Fortis FMRI is a JCI-certified hospital known for its cutting-edge technology and patient care.

Departments:

  • Bone marrow transplants, oncology, cardiac care.
  • Critical care, liver and kidney transplants.
  • Orthopedics and spine surgery.

What Sets Fortis Apart:
FMRI is often called the ‘Mecca of Healthcare’ for its advanced infrastructure and renowned faculty.

5. Tata Memorial Hospital, Mumbai

Tata Memorial Hospital is India’s leading cancer care center, providing affordable and often free treatment to thousands of patients every year.

Specialties:

  • Oncology, radiation therapy, bone marrow transplants.
  • Cutting-edge clinical trials and research.
  • Pediatric oncology and preventive oncology.

Highlight:
Tata Memorial sets global standards in cancer research and treatment protocols.

6. Christian Medical College (CMC), Vellore

CMC Vellore is an institution with a heart, combining excellent treatment with affordable care.

Specialties:

  • Cardiac sciences, neurology, nephrology.
  • Organ transplants and plastic surgery.
  • Community health and rural outreach.

Why It’s Loved:
CMC is globally respected for its ethical, patient-first approach and world-class teaching hospital facilities.

7. Max Super Speciality Hospital, Saket, New Delhi

Max Healthcare is a trusted name in private healthcare, and its Saket unit is a flagship hospital.

Departments:

  • Oncology, cardiac sciences, neurosciences.
  • Robotic surgeries, orthopedics, IVF.
  • Organ transplants and critical care.

Unique Strength:
Max Saket attracts patients not just from India but also from the Middle East, CIS countries, and Africa.

8. Lilavati Hospital and Research Centre, Mumbai

Lilavati is one of Mumbai’s most trusted names for multi-specialty care.

Specialties:

  • Advanced diagnostic services.
  • Cardiac surgery, oncology, gastroenterology.
  • Pediatrics, obstetrics, and gynecology.

Why Patients Recommend It:
Known for its patient-centric services and excellent outcomes.

9. Sir Ganga Ram Hospital, New Delhi

With a legacy spanning over 65 years, Sir Ganga Ram Hospital is one of North India’s top private hospitals.

Departments:

  • Gastroenterology, nephrology, renal sciences.
  • Orthopedics and joint replacements.
  • Minimal access surgery.

Highlight:
Sir Ganga Ram combines affordability with high-quality care, serving thousands every year.

10. BLK-Max Super Speciality Hospital, New Delhi

BLK-Max is one of India’s largest stand-alone private hospitals with 650+ beds.

Key Specialties:

  • Oncology, bone marrow transplants.
  • Liver and kidney transplants.
  • Robotic surgeries and cardiac sciences.

What Makes It Stand Out:
BLK-Max is particularly known for complex cancer and transplant cases.

Tips for Choosing the Best Hospital in India

With so many excellent hospitals, how do you pick the right one for your treatment? Here’s a quick checklist:

  1. Check Accreditations: Look for NABH, JCI, or ISO certifications.
  2. Research the Doctors: Verify their experience, specializations, and patient reviews.
  3. Understand the Costs: Get clear, written estimates to avoid surprises.
  4. Look at Support Services: Especially if you’re an international patient — does the hospital offer visa help, translators, or
  5. accommodation?
  6. Compare Success Rates: For surgeries like organ transplants, oncology, or cardiac surgery, success rates matter.

Why India is a Global Hub for Medical Tourism

Patients from Africa, South Asia, the Middle East, and even developed nations travel to India every year. Here’s why:

  • Massive Cost Savings: Treatments can be 50–70% cheaper than in the US or UK.
  • No Waiting Times: Quick access to surgeries that might otherwise take months abroad.
  • High-Quality Care: International standards with compassionate doctors and nursing staff.
  • Tourism and Recovery: Many patients combine treatment with India’s wellness retreats or heritage tourism.

According to industry estimates, India’s medical tourism market will reach $13 billion by 2026.
